Announcing a total federal investment of $99.3 million in affordable housing in Windsor-Essex
July 30, 2021
I was excited to join Ahmed Hussen, the Minister of Families, Children, and Social Development in Windsor-Tecumseh - along with Mayor Drew Dilkens and Mayor Gary McNamara - to announce a historic $90 million in federal funding for the repair & renewal of our existing stock of affordable housing and an additional $9.3 million through the Rapid Housing Initiative to build 35 new units for our most vulnerable neighbours.
That is a total federal investment today of $99.3 million in affordable housing in Windsor-Essex. This is a historic investment and a game changer for our community.
Together, in just the last two years alone, our federal government has invested $149 million to grow and improve the supply of affordable housing in Windsor-Essex.
